Como adicionar ou subtrair ou incrementar letras de coluna no Excel? 2ª parte

0

Eu encontrei este link onde é respondido:

Como adicionar ou subtrair ou incrementar letras de coluna no Excel?

Desta vez, quero saber como simplificar:

=INDIRECT( ADDRESS( ROW()+19, ( COLUMN() - 1 ),4) )
=INDIRECT( ADDRESS( ROW()+19, ( COLUMN() - 3 ),4) )
=INDIRECT( ADDRESS( ROW()+19, ( COLUMN() - 5 ),4) )

para:

=INDIRECT( ADDRESS( ROW()+19, ( COLUMN() - (2*n-1) ),4) )
    
por Another.Chemist 03.08.2016 / 00:42

1 resposta

1

Para dar um valor a n para ter uma função de trabalho, você deve escrever em vez de n o seguinte: %código% A fórmula será: Row()
o 4 em 2 * (ROW () - 4) -1) é o número da linha -1 onde você inicia a fórmula, eu usei por exemplo a linha 5 eu tenho que deduzir 1 dela, e ela dará 1 após o cálculo com 2 * (ROW () - 4) -1) = 2 * (5-4) -1 = 2-1 = 1 A fórmula se tornará:
=INDIRECT( ADDRESS( ROW()+19, ( COLUMN() - (2*(ROW()-4)-1) ),4) ) , mas você tem que escrever o valor de Row number -1, (Row () - 1) = 4 por exemplo, dessa forma quando você arrastar para baixo a fórmula deduzirá sempre 4 e isso significa 1, 3 5 ...

    
por 03.08.2016 / 08:00